Im making a system based on the beagleboard x15 which has a sitara AM5728 which boots from a 4GB eMMC FLASH.

My design will connect to a larger host system by uart and a bit bashed 8-bit databus parallel interface.

I need to be able to update the firmware in my design from the host system.

As is stands the sitara loads its code from the eMMC FLASH and runs from ddr.

Is it possible to send a new firmware image to my design (over either of the 2 interfaces mentioned) and write the image into a different section of the eMMC FLASH.

Then somehow tell the sitara to boot starting from a different address in the eMMC memory.

(As to avoid bricking I wouldnt want to just write over the single image in the eMMC FLASH)
